What problem does it solve?

This Skill addresses the complexity of designing, implementing, and optimizing cloud infrastructure across multiple providers, ensuring scalability, security, and cost-efficiency.

Core Features & Use Cases

  • Multi-Cloud Strategy: Develop comprehensive strategies for AWS, Azure, and GCP.
  • Architecture Design: Create resilient, secure, and cost-effective cloud-native systems.
  • Cost Optimization: Identify and implement strategies to reduce cloud spending.
  • Security Architecture: Design robust security measures adhering to best practices.
  • Use Case: A company needs to migrate its on-premises application to the cloud. This Skill can design a multi-cloud architecture that balances cost, performance, and disaster recovery requirements.
